					1916 25c PCGS MS65 Gem Barber Quarter 
					
						
							
							
								
									
									
									Wow! This lustrous 1916 25c PCGS MS65 Barber Quarter is a gem indeed! Needle sharp motifs are bold and highlighted by a nice even satin luster. Fields are well preserved. Mostly white with a subtle gold patina most notable on obverse. A lovely example!
  
With a total mintage of 1,788,000 pieces the final year of the Barber design saw regular production at the Philadelphia Mint. This resulted in a common issue which is not hard to find in all grades. The reason probably is that at least some were set apart by collectors of the time as a momentum to the design introduced in 1892.
  
This particular piece exhibits a sharp strike on lustrous surfaces, highlighted by satin luster. There are no major hits, making this a true GEM piece. Virtually untoned with subtle gold patina. A great coin for the discriminating type or date set collector!
